Accessing API Documentation. The API documentation can be accessed at: Pushshift API Docs. On the top right, Press ‘Authorize’. Paste the access token into the field and press ‘authorize’ once again. To explore the API document, select a function call and press ‘Try it out’. Type in queries and press ‘execute’ when complete. From the FAQ , The Pushshift API serves a copy of reddit objects. Currently, data is copied into Pushshift at the time it is posted to reddit. Therefore, scores and other meta such as edits to a submission's selftext or a comment's body field may not reflect what is displayed by reddit.Feb 21, 2019 ... Pushshift is a data collection and analysis platform that specializes in archiving and indexing social media data for research purposes. It is particularly known for its extensive collection of Reddit data. The Pushshift API provides a powerful interface for querying and retrieving this Reddit data in a structured format. About. Display removed (by mods) and deleted (by users) comments/posts for Reddit. PC Usage: Press Ctrl-Shift-B to view the bookmark bar, and then drag this bookmarklet: Unddit to the bar and click it when viewing a Reddit post. Alternatively you can manually replace the www.reddit.com in the URL with undelete.pullpush.io. E.g. https://undelete ...

I know there is Archiveteam, but that only … For subreddit pages, it compares what is recorded in Pushshift to what appears on the subreddit page. The code uses Jason Baumgartner's Pushshift API to determine whether content was removed immediately (by automod) or whether it was removed later (likely by a moderator).
